Major Greene County, Ohio Real Estate Markets

Beavercreek stands as Greene County's crown jewel, offering upscale residential communities and proximity to Wright-Patterson Air Force Base, which creates consistent demand from military families and defense contractors. Fairborn complements this dynamic with more affordable housing options while maintaining excellent school districts, making it particularly attractive to young families and first-time homebuyers seeking value without sacrificing quality of life.

Xenia, the county seat, provides a fascinating blend of historic charm and revitalization efforts, with downtown development projects attracting investors interested in mixed-use properties and commercial real estate opportunities. Yellow Springs adds an artistic and educational dimension to the market, thanks to Antioch College's influence, creating unique demand for eclectic properties and sustainable housing options that appeal to creative professionals and academics.

Market Dynamics and Geographic Complexity

Greene County's real estate market benefits from its strategic position within the Dayton metropolitan statistical area while maintaining distinct suburban and rural character zones. The county experiences surprising price variations across relatively short distances, with Beavercreek commanding premium prices while areas like Cedarville offer exceptional value for buyers seeking small-town atmosphere with big-city accessibility.

Seasonal patterns here differ from typical Ohio markets due to the military presence and academic calendar influences, creating off-peak opportunities that savvy investors and businesses can leverage. The market also shows remarkable resilience during economic fluctuations, largely due to the stable employment base provided by Wright-Patterson Air Force Base and the diverse mix of manufacturing, healthcare, and educational institutions throughout the region.
